Bathroom Remodeling FAQs
When you are contemplating about a refurbishment of your bathroom, there are numerous questions that come up.
Here are some of the usual concerns asked and some beneficial answers!
What is involved in a bathroom remodel?
A bathroom reconstruct involves replacing one or more existing parts, machines, exteriors, and finishes in a room to give it a fresh look. It can vary from relatively easy endeavors that update an ancient bathroom with recent tile or a fresh vanity to intricate multi-fixture jobs of the whole room.In any case, there are a few elementary steps you can anticipate in the majority of bathroom redesigns.
The full process of replacing all fixtures and endings requires a bit of understanding of fixtures, woodwork, and wiring. Also, rules from your area building department may mandate the services of an accredited constructor. You should discuss with with your developer or architect first to discover more about these details."
Is there anything I must to do before a bathroom remodel?
You should choose the parts you desire well beforehand of your remodel. If the modes or colors are not accessible, it may be essential to put off your remodeling until they are back in supply. Also, decide if you intend to do a full demolition and remove all existing components and finishes before the redesign starts.
Taking out everything will save time on the redesign, but it will also necessitate more storage space. Your constructor should be capable to offer instruction on this crucial question.
How long will the bathroom redesign take?
The majority of residential bathrooms are completed within 7-12 days after all work order approvals have been procured from your community construction division and subcontractors are ready for site meetings.
What is included in a bathroom reconstruct?
Anticipate to replace your current toilet, sink(s), cabinets, floor surface and components. The majority of bathrooms are being redesigned with tile or stone floors and wet walls currently rather than sheet vinyl.

What are the most in-demand bathroom shower styles?
The most regular is a tub/shower combo succeeded by a walk-in shower and conventional bathtub. However, there is a rising requirement for standalone showers due to the space they conserve in smaller bathrooms and their user-friendliness with the elderly population.
Does a walk-in shower add significance to a bathroom?
A bathroom with a walk-in shower will contribute more worth to your house than one with a tub/shower combo. In fact, several people are selecting to redesign their bathrooms to fit standalone showers when developing new homes or for reasons of greater ease while bathing.
What is the optimal wideness and longness for a walk-in shower?
Anything less than 30" in width is not advised, as it's challenging to get in and out of. A 36" wide shower is usually a preferred width for the majority of people. As far as length goes – the customary size is 5 feet, but anything from 3 to 6 feet in length would be fine if you have the space.

Do I have to be concerned about insulation?
Waterproof insulation behind the shower's waterproofing layer is crucial to evade a frigid, humid shower during cold weather.
How do I ensure the wall surface from getting too wet?
An abundance of dampness can impair your tiling and grout, resulting in them to wipe away or alter dye. The optimal remedy is to choose well-designed tiles with proper drainage. For areas that demand extra protection, you can use a drainage mat.

What is the optimal floor for bathrooms?
Ceramic tile is almost always a top-notch option for floors in bathrooms and other wet areas. The grout lines can be sealed with a coating that will help avert mold growth and water impairment. Marble is another solid flooring selection for bathrooms. If the marble is processed, it can be employed outdoors as well. With a refined finish, and pleasant sheen, it requires fewer care than various stone kinds. Stone slabs or pavers will persist essentially forever but are not always very comfy on bare feet (because of their rough edges).
